Summary
The Meal Scale Trend of 2026 is reshaping the food industry by blending nutrition, sensory experiences, and technological advancements. It focuses on achieving balance—combining health with indulgence and innovation with convenience. Increasing consumer demand for whole foods rich in fiber and protein, alongside functional ingredients promoting well-being, is driving the integration of AI and smart kitchen devices in meal planning and preparation.

Technological Integration
The integration of digital technology such as AI and IoT is essential to the Meal Scale Trend, enhancing personalized meal recommendations and optimizing supply chains for reduced food waste. Smart kitchen tools, including advanced scales, connect with nutrition apps, transforming meal preparation into a health-focused activity. These developments facilitate better dietary tracking and meal planning, underscoring the trend’s commitment to convenience and sustainability.
